Happy Holidays the Book Club way!

Hi all, we had a fabulous time with our third annual Holiday Book Swap. We laughed and laughed, all the while trading around great books with great stories about how we picked them. What a wide range of interests are represented in the group! It was great.

The most traded book of the evening was Hilary Mantel's most recent book, The Assassination of Margaret Thatcher, a collection of short stories and a departure from Thomas Cromwell. That will be our January book, and I can't wait. If it hadn't been sitting on my shelf, I would also have claimed it!

Although it did not get traded, there was lots of interest in the book Dawn brought that Fiona was lucky enough to get, called Empire of the Summer Moon. It is the rise and fall of the Comanche and we selected that as our February book.
